There’s a new outbreak of Ebola in Africa. Here’s what you need to know

The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C) has declared a new Ebola outbreak in Kasai Province. It’s caused by the most severe strain: Zaire Ebola virus. This outbreak began with a 34-year-old pregnant woman who was admitted to hospital on August 20 and died five days later. Two health workers who treated her also became infected and died. By September 15, there were 81 confirmed cases and 28 deaths, including four health workers. The DRC has had 15 prior Ebola epidemics, with the largest in 2019 and the most recent in 2022. But genetic analysis shows the outbreak likely began after a spillover from an animal to a human, rather than a continuation of earlier outbreaks. Atiku hails Hilda Baci for breaking world record with Nigerian Jollof rice

Former Vice President Atiku Abubakar has extended his congratulations to celebrity chef Hilda Baci and food brand Gino after they entered the record books with the largest serving of Nigerian-style Jollof rice. Atiku described the accomplishment as more than a culinary milestone, noting that it reflects the ingenuity and determination of Nigerians to excel on the global stage. He said the recognition is “yet another reminder that our people can break records, set standards, and inspire the world,” adding that such achievements continue to strengthen national pride. The record-breaking event has further spotlighted Nigerian Jollof, a dish long celebrated across West Africa, and placed it on an international platform through the efforts of Baci and her collaborators. Britain’s top cop hails Live Facial Recognition technology as a ‘game-changing’ tool

Metropolitan Police Commissioner Sir Mark Rowley has hailed live facial recognition (LFR) as a "game-changing tool" for policing. During a speech, he emphasised its effectiveness in tackling crime, citing its use in making hundreds of arrests in 2025. Key Details and Usage Arrest Statistics: According to Sir Mark, LFR has led to over 700 arrests this year alone, including more than 50 registered sex offenders who were in breach of their conditions. Targeted Use: He stressed that the technology is used responsibly and is focused on locating serious offenders, such as wanted individuals, registered sex offenders, and those wanted for violent crimes. Operational Expansion: The Metropolitan Police plans to more than double the use of LFR, increasing deployments to up to 10 times per week across five days, up from the current four times a week across two days.
